Playing Styles: A Clash of Titans

Alright, now let's get down to the nitty-gritty – their playing styles. This is where things get really interesting! Tsitsipas and Zverev are both top-tier players, but they bring distinct approaches to the court. Understanding their strengths, weaknesses, and preferred tactics is crucial for predicting how this match might unfold.

Let's start with Stefanos Tsitsipas. This Greek god of tennis is known for his aggressive baseline game, powerful forehand, and elegant one-handed backhand. He loves to dictate play from the baseline, using his forehand to generate pace and spin. His one-handed backhand, while a thing of beauty, can sometimes be vulnerable against high-bouncing balls or aggressive opponents. Tsitsipas is also a very good serve-and-volleyer, adding another dimension to his game. He's a fighter, a showman, and a true competitor.

Now, let's turn our attention to Alexander Zverev. The German powerhouse boasts a booming serve, a solid baseline game, and a relentless competitive spirit. Zverev's serve is arguably his biggest weapon, allowing him to win cheap points and put pressure on his opponents. He's also a very consistent ball-striker from the baseline, capable of trading blows with the best in the world. However, Zverev has sometimes struggled with his mental game in crucial moments, particularly in Grand Slam tournaments. He's a force to be reckoned with, but consistency under pressure is key.

The contrast in their playing styles makes this matchup so compelling. Tsitsipas likes to build points with his forehand and move forward to the net, while Zverev prefers to dominate with his serve and grind opponents down from the baseline. How will these contrasting styles mesh on the court? Will Tsitsipas be able to exploit Zverev's backhand? Will Zverev's serve prove too much for Tsitsipas to handle?

The surface they're playing on will also influence the match dynamics. On faster surfaces like hard courts, Zverev's serve will be even more potent, giving him a significant advantage. On slower surfaces like clay, Tsitsipas's ability to generate spin and construct points will be more effective.
